The Golden Triangle is a classic introduction to India and comprises of the three most visited cities in the country's north-west - Delhi, Agra and Jaipur. Walk the crowded streets of the sprawling and fascinating Indian capital, Delhi, and tour around all of the main attractions . You'll also get the chance to explore Agra, once the heart of the Mughal empire that boasts the unparalleled beauty of the Taj Mahal.
The highlight of any trip to India has to be seeing the magnificent Taj Mahal. Arguably the most beautiful building in the world, the Taj Mahal is a symbol of India that is a must see on any trip to the country. Everyone will be up bright and early to make our way to the Taj Mahal for sunrise and an English-speaking guide will teach you all about the story that inspired the building of the Taj Mahal and the sad tragedy involved in creating it.

Based on the South West coast, you will spend 4 days and 3 nights in Goa where you can truly experience India's very own pocket-sized paradise! With no planned itinerary, this is time for you and your new found friends to truly enjoy yourselves, whether that be relaxing or taking part in some of the many activities on offer.
Goa offers an eclectic mix of Portuguese heritage, a wonderful climate, lush green jungles and exotic food. If you're a beach lover looking to soak up the sun on some golden sands then you will be in your element. If you’re flying to the other side of the world, why not break your long journey up with a stopover in Dubai? Enjoy 4 days and 3 nights in this glamorous state that will amaze you in every way. Be in awe of the sheer scale of this powerhouse city as you wander the vast streets surrounded by hundreds of skyscrapers.
Head to the top of the world as you climb up the Burj Khalifa – the tallest building in the world at 828 metres high (additional cost)! Get lost in Dubai Mall, the world’s largest shopping centre with over 1200 shops and restaurants and head outside to watch the fantastic water and light show at Dubai Fountain.
Alongside all of the glitz and glamour, Dubai also has historic neighbourhoods, colourful souqs (markets), museums, mosques, beaches and of course the desert!
